*FINE FACTORY ENGRAVED COLT SINGLE ACTION ARMY REVOLVER. SN 307680. Cal. 38 WCF. Nickel finish with 5-1/2″ bbl, full front sight, 1-line block letter address & caliber marking on left side. Left side of frame has 2-line 3-patent dates and rampant colt in a circle. Mounted with 2-pc smooth pearl grips. Revolver is engraved, probably from the shop of Cuno Helfrecht, in about B-level consisting of about 60% coverage foliate arabesque patterns with a fine flower blossom on left recoil shield and a sunburst on the loading gate with matching sunburst at top of back strap. Engraving extends over the top strap & bbl with geometric patterns on back strap & butt strap. Trigger guard is engraved in a hunter’s star. Cyl has a sunburst pattern on the lands between the flutes and a snake & dot pattern around the rear edge. Accompanied by a Colt factory letter which identifies this revolver with 5-1/2″ bbl, nickel finish, type of stocks not listed, factory engraved and shipped to H & D Folsom Arms Co., New York, NY, April 14, 1909 in a 3-gun shipment. CONDITION: Very fine to extremely fine. Overall retains virtually all of a fine factory style restored finish with some slight dulling on the bbl that may clean better. Right grip has a tiny chip out of the heel, otherwise grips are sound with great fire & color. Hammer is not solid in safety notch, otherwise mechanics are fine, slightly frosty bore. 4-48157 JR281 (10,000-15,000)
